Output 4073e616b72afebb606590d3c2f83b67ebfa2700e74e3763665cbd7fa3deec58:1

value
999529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9b5d5766a646b32c72be7435efbf9ff5b133d2 OP_EQUAL
address
3JtH5Xj4mHzXktakU2AWP27Y7SSAEnVgQQ
transaction
4073e616b72afebb606590d3c2f83b67ebfa2700e74e3763665cbd7fa3deec58
spent
true